Collectively, our leadership has over 300 years of experience in sales and sponsorship, analytics and valuation, hospitality and operations. Responsibilities
- Provide level 1 & 2 support to all point-of-sale system problems and escalate when necessary
- Initiates and implement improvements to areas of responsibility
- Conduct venue walk-through to ensure all systems are operational prior to and during all events
- Replacement of defective hardware before, during and after events
- Diagnoses of software, firmware & hardware errors and breakage
- Maintain a thorough knowledge of the organization and adheres to all standards and practices Qualifications Solid analytical and problem-solving skills; proven ability to organize, manage, and complete multiple tasks in an efficient and timely fashion; strong verbal and written communication and the ability to establish and maintain effective working relationships with all internal and external stakeholders.
- Must be able to adapt to environment changes immediately
- Highly effective oral presentation and written communication skills
- Working knowledge of Microsoft applications to include operating system, office systems
- Ability to be on feet and walk long distances
- Ability to lift at least 50 lbs.
